I have 1 wall switch connected to two porch lights. Can I remove the lights, install fans, and have them work off 1 universal wall control?

Stratmando
Mar 21, 2008, 01:02 PM
You would need to verify you have enough support for fan,
You could leave switch in place and use light kit(s). Then they could all be switched on and off where you left settings.
1 control can control 2 fans, has to handle current and you lose lighting ability.
You could install remote receiver in each fan, and have separate fan and light control.

"1 universal wall control" do you mean the existing switch, yes you can. Like Strat points out you must confirm you have a good attachement for the fans. You can buy hanger kits made to fit inside the opening of a light box and then expand to dig into the two ceiling rafters above the ceiling of the porch. Are you using fans with small chains to control the speeds or what?

Would the ceiling fans have lights? If so, we will need to determine how many wires you have, and how you want them controlled.

If you will be using a speed control, make sure it is capable of handling more than one fan.
